[résolu]wheezy mot de passe perdu

Un acte de bonne volonté, que diable …

Ici.

re
je signale que ma distro wheezy ne demarre pas en mode graphique, je dois jongler avec mon autre distro pour acceder au forum, moi je veux bien faire tout ce qu’on me dit ,mais faire un copier coller d’une distro en mode console pour le mettre dans une autre en mode graphique pour poster je sais pas faire si quelqu’un veut m’expliquer comment faire je suis preneur

[quote=“jdum”]bonjour BelZeButh
le gestionnaire de connection c’est lightdm l’environnement de bureau c’est mate et je pense de plus en plus que le probleme c’est x qui demarre pas, parce que quand je rentre mon login et mon passwd dans le gestionnaire de connection ça mouline un peu et ça me renvoie pas de message d’erreur comme quoi le login ou le passwd sont erronés[/quote]
Non, X démarre dès le lancement de lightdm donc fonctionne. Ton souci est un problème de gestion de connexion. Tu peux le voir en faisant la chose suivante:

Tu passes root sur une console:

/etc/init.d/lightdm stop

puis tu te logues sous ta session (sur une des 6 consoles donc) et tu tapes startx, ça devrait marcher

Pour info.

[quote=“jdum”]re
je dois jongler avec mon autre distro pour acceder au forum
[/quote]
Ou, depuis un live-dvd et chrooter le système posant souci.

rediriger sortie commande linux vers fichier .txt

re
j’ai stoppé lightdm j’ai fait startx ça marche pas ça m’envoie un message d’erreur et j’arrive pas à passer le resultat de la console dans un fichier, j’ai creé un fichier pour ça dans mon home, et j’arrive pas a transferer la sortie de la console dedans par contre pour fran.b voici le contenu du fichier /etc/init.d/lightdm si ça peut etre utile
#! /bin/sh

BEGIN INIT INFO

Provides: lightdm

Should-Start: console-screen kbd acpid dbus hal consolekit

Required-Start: $local_fs $remote_fs x11-common

Required-Stop: $local_fs $remote_fs

Default-Start: 2 3 4 5

Default-Stop: 0 1 6

Short-Description: Light Display Manager

Description: Debian init script for the Light Display Manager

END INIT INFO

Author: Yves-Alexis Perez corsac@debian.org using gdm script from

Ryan Murray rmurray@debian.org

set -e

PATH=/sbin:/bin:/usr/sbin:/usr/bin
DAEMON=/usr/sbin/lightdm

test -x $DAEMON || exit 0

if [ -r /etc/default/locale ]; then
. /etc/default/locale
export LANG LANGUAGE
fi

. /lib/lsb/init-functions

To start lightdm even if it is not the default display manager, change

HEED_DEFAULT_DISPLAY_MANAGER to “false.”

HEED_DEFAULT_DISPLAY_MANAGER=true
DEFAULT_DISPLAY_MANAGER_FILE=/etc/X11/default-display-manager

case “$1” in
start)
CONFIGURED_DAEMON=$(basename “$(cat $DEFAULT_DISPLAY_MANAGER_FILE 2> /dev/null)”)
if grep -wqs text /proc/cmdline; then
log_warning_msg "Not starting Light Display Manager (lightdm); found ‘text’ in kernel commandline."
elif [ -e “$DEFAULT_DISPLAY_MANAGER_FILE” ] &&
[ “$HEED_DEFAULT_DISPLAY_MANAGER” = “true” ] &&
[ “$CONFIGURED_DAEMON” != lightdm ] ; then
log_action_msg "Not starting Light Display Manager; it is not the default display manager"
else
log_daemon_msg “Starting Light Display Manager” "lightdm"
start-stop-daemon --start --quiet --pidfile /var/run/lightdm.pid --name lightdm --exec $DAEMON -b|| echo -n " already running"
log_end_msg $?
fi
;;
stop)
log_daemon_msg “Stopping Light Display Manager” "lightdm"
set +e
start-stop-daemon --stop --quiet --pidfile /var/run/lightdm.pid
–name lightdm --retry 5
set -e
log_end_msg $?
;;
reload)
log_daemon_msg “Scheduling reload of Light Display Manager configuration” "lightdm"
set +e
start-stop-daemon --stop --signal USR1 --quiet --pidfile
/var/run/lightdm.pid --name lightdm
set -e
log_end_msg $?
;;
status)
status_of_proc -p “$PIDFILE” “$DAEMON” lightdm && exit 0 || exit $?
;;
restart|force-reload)
$0 stop
sleep 1
$0 start
;;
*)
echo "Usage: /etc/init.d/lightdm {start|stop|restart|reload|force-reload|status}"
exit 1
;;
esac

exit 0

[quote=“jdum”]voici le contenu du fichier /etc/init.d/lightdm [strike]si ça peut etre utile[/strike]

....

Ce ([strike]retour[/strike]) script est sans intérêt.

Notes: [strike]on avance[/strike], à présent tu maîtrises le copier/coller. :033

Un acte de bonne volonté, que diable …

[quote=“BelZéButh”]

rediriger sortie commande linux vers fichier .txt[/quote]

re
non je ne maitrise pas le copier/coller,j’ai simplement accès à ma partition wheezy a partir de ma partition arch,j’ai recuperé le contenu de /etc/init.d/lightdm depuis ma partition arch,j’ai crée un fichier pour recuperer le retour de la console dans mon home wheezy mais j’arrive pas à y coller le resultat pour poster

Ou, depuis un live-dvd et chrooter le système posant souci.
[/quote]
Alors, chrootes le système posant souci, [mono]Wheezy[/mono] en l’occurrence.

re
je suis désolé je comprends rien,je voudrais simplement a partir de la console wheezy remettre les choses en ordre,apparement c’est compliqué, je vais laisser tomber pour le moment et je reinstallerais wheezy quand j’aurais le temps,j’avais installé debian parce que je voulais tango studio pour faire de la musique et que il y avait une distro toute prete sur une base wheezy en live-dvd ,est-ce que je peux reparer avec le live-dvd puisque je l’ai, et si oui comment ,sinon je vais installer une arch de base et installer tout le necessaire tango studio dessus ,j’ai jamais eu ces problemes avec arch et quand j’en ai eu ça à été plus facile à solutionner, apparement debian c’est plus complexe que arch

Oui. Et, c’est pas trop tôt …

Redémarres depuis ce dernier, ouvres un terminal en tant qu’user lambda, généralement (depuis un live-dvd Debian) on passera du compte lambda ($) à celui de root en invoquant simplement cette commande.
[mono]$ sudo -s[/mono] et donnes nous les retours suivants, dans un premier temps.

[code]# fdisk -l

blkid

mount[/code]

Que je sache, c’est tout le contraire.

Pour enregistrer la sortie standard et la sortie d’erreur d’une commande dans des fichiers :

Quand bien même, il reste possible de recopier le message d’erreur à la main (oui, avec un crayon !) ou au pire d’en prendre une photographie.

re
je laisse tomber, ça fait deux jours que je me prends la tete j’aurais eu plus vite fait de tout reinstaller,je vais installer une arch avec les paquets pour la mao qui vont bien,ça sera plus facile,arch c’est moins compliqué que debian, quand j’ai installé mon arch je me suis pas autant pris le chou ,j’ai installé la base avec un cd et ensuite j’ai tout construit en ligne de commande, j’ai installé mon environnement de bureau,mon gestionnaire de connection,le son,le wifi, le driver de ma carte graphique ,xorg,modem manager , les logiciels de base et roule ma poule,et quand j’ai besoin d’une appli particuliere je l’installe au coup par coup, et quand ça plante c’est plus facile à reparer, c’est une idée reçue que arch c’est compliqué
je vous remercie tous pour le mal que vous vous êtes donné

[quote=“jdum”]re
je laisse tomber, ça fait deux jours que je me prends la tete j’aurais eu plus vite fait de tout reinstaller,je vais installer une arch avec les paquets pour la mao qui vont bien,ça sera plus facile,arch c’est moins compliqué que debian, quand j’ai installé mon arch je me suis pas autant pris le chou ,j’ai installé la base avec un cd et ensuite j’ai tout construit en ligne de commande, j’ai installé mon environnement de bureau,mon gestionnaire de connection,le son,le wifi, le driver de ma carte graphique ,xorg,modem manager , les logiciels de base et roule ma poule,et quand j’ai besoin d’une appli particuliere je l’installe au coup par coup, et quand ça plante c’est plus facile à reparer, c’est une idée reçue que arch c’est compliqué
je vous remercie tous pour le mal que vous vous êtes donné[/quote]

Ce n’est certainement pas un problème typique à Debian, cela serait mieux de comprendre la raison de ce dysfonctionnement que tu pourrais rencontrer sur une autre distri aussi.
Je viens de cloner un système/home Debian sur une autre machine (plus rapide que tout réinstaller) et j’avais le même symptôme:
impossible de loguer graphiquement même avec un nouvel utilisateur alors que le gestionnaire lightdm se lançait bien, et cela venait de /tmp qui n’avait les droits d’écritures que pour root…

bonjour jim
t’as solutionné comment? ,parce que c’est vrai ça me fait un peu ch…de tout reinstaller et que honnetement debian marche bien et que j’ai critiqué sous le coup de l’énervement, avec lightdm j’ai essayé de me logger en root mais ça marche pas, j’ai essayé comme login root et admin mais t’as peut-etre fait autrement

1 + 1 = 1 … :whistle: :005

Effectivement, l’éternel relation Chaise/Clavier … :033

Le répertoire [mono]/home[/mono] n’est pas à proprement dit un [mono]system[/mono].

[quote]Système de fichiers de type UNIX

Avec GNU/Linux et d’autres systèmes d’exploitation semblables à UNIX, les fichiers sont organisés en répertoires. Tous les fichiers et les répertoires sont disposés sous forme d’une grosse arborescence ancrée sur « / ». On l’appelle un arbre parce que si vous dessinez le système de fichiers, il ressemble à un arbre qui se trouverait disposé la tête en bas.

Ces fichiers et répertoires peuvent être répartis sur plusieurs périphériques. La commande mount(8) sert à attacher les systèmes de fichiers se trouvant sur certains périphériques à la grosse arborescence des fichiers. À l’opposé, la commande umount(8) les détachera de nouveau. Avec les noyaux Linux récents, mount(8) avec certaines options peut lier une partie d’une arborescence de fichiers à un autre emplacement ou peut monter un système de fichiers de manière partagée, privée, esclave ou « non-liable ». Vous trouverez les options de montage prises en compte par chaque système de fichiers dans « /share/doc/linux-doc-*/Documentation/filesystems/ ».

Les répertoires d’un système UNIX sont appelés dossiers sur d’autres systèmes. Vous remarquez aussi qu’il n’y a, sur aucun système UNIX, de concept de lecteur tel que « A: ». Il y a un système de fichiers qui comprend tout. C’est un gros avantage comparé à Windows.

Bases concernant les fichiers UNIX

Voici les bases des fichiers UNIX :

les noms de fichiers sont sensibles à la casse. Ce qui veut dire que « MONFICHIER » et « MonFichier » sont des fichiers différents ;

on se réfère au répertoire racine (« root directory »), qui est la racine du système de fichiers, simplement par « / ». Ne pas le confondre avec le répertoire personnel de l’utilisateur root : « /root » ;

un nom de répertoire peut être constitué de n’importe quelle lettre ou symbole sauf « / ». Le répertoire racine est une exception, son nom est « / » (prononcé « slash » ou « le répertoire racine »), il ne peut pas être renommé ;

chaque fichier ou répertoire est désigné par un nom de fichier entièrement qualifié, nom de fichier absolu ou chemin, indiquant la séquence de répertoires que l’on doit traverser pour l’atteindre. Les trois expressions sont synonymes ;

tous les noms de fichiers entièrement qualifiés commencent par le répertoire « / » et il y a un / » entre chaque répertoire ou fichier dans le nom du fichier. Le premier « / » est le répertoire de plus haut niveau, et les autres « / » séparent les sous-répertoires successifs jusqu’à ce que l’on atteigne la dernière entrée qui est le nom fichier proprement dit. Les mots utilisés ici peuvent être source de confusion. Prenez comme exemple le nom pleinement qualifié suivant : « /usr/share/keytables/us.map.gz ». Cependant, les gens utiliseront souvent son nom de base « us.map.gz » seul comme nom de fichier ;

le répertoire racine comporte de nombreuses branches, telles que « /etc/ » et « /usr/ ». Ces sous-répertoires se décomposent eux-mêmes en d’autres sous-répertoires comme « /etc/init.d/ » et « /usr/local/ ». L’ensemble de la chose, vu globalement, s’appelle l’arborescence des répertoires. Vous pouvez imaginer un nom de fichier absolu comme une route partant de la base de l’arbre (« / ») jusqu’à l’extrémité de certaines branches (le fichier). Vous entendrez aussi certains parler de l’arborescence des répertoires comme d’un arbre généalogique englobant tous les descendants directs d’un seul personnage appelé le répertoire racine (« / ») : les sous-répertoires ont alors des parents et un chemin montre l’ascendance complète d’un fichier. Il y a aussi des chemins relatifs qui commencent quelque part ailleurs qu’au niveau du répertoire racine. Il faut vous souvenir que le répertoire « ../ » indique le répertoire parent. Cette terminologie s’applique de la même manière aux autres structures ressemblant aux répertoires comme les structures de données hiérarchiques ;

[/quote]

[quote]Utilisation des répertoires-clés

répertoire utilisation du répertoire

/ répertoire racine
/etc/ fichiers de configuration valables pour l’ensemble du système
/var/log/ fichiers journaux du système
/home/ tous les répertoires personnels des utilisateurs non privilégiés [/quote]

[quote]Je viens de cloner un [strike]système[/strike]/home Debian sur une autre machine (plus rapide que tout réinstaller)
[/quote]
Or, selon tes propos, nous étions en droit de penser que tu ne disposer que d’un système [mono]Arch[/mono] et [mono]Wheezy[/mono] …

[quote]cela venait de /tmp qui n’avait les droits d’écritures que pour root…
[/quote]
Plutôt étrange ton histoire.
Qui avait donc ces droits … ?

[11:12:50]:/tmp$ ll total 2,1M -rw-r--r-- 1 root root 245 2015-03-29 11:12 cronenv -rw-r--r-- 1 root root 55K 2015-03-29 10:23 .liste_surveillance -rw------- 1 loreleil loreleil 2,0M 2015-03-29 08:53 dpkg.log drwx------ 2 loreleil loreleil 460 2015-03-28 17:41 kde-loreleil drwx------ 2 loreleil loreleil 40 2015-03-28 17:41 aptitude-loreleil.15086:nWsdr8 drwx------ 2 loreleil loreleil 40 2015-03-25 18:38 aptitude-loreleil.19112:NVDcA2 -rw------- 1 loreleil loreleil 1,1K 2015-03-22 10:57 tmp.GLbCQhEGcf drwx------ 2 loreleil loreleil 100 2015-03-22 08:54 ksocket-loreleil drwx------ 2 loreleil loreleil 40 2015-03-22 08:54 pulse-TH9JcgyeBnZi drwx------ 2 loreleil loreleil 80 2015-03-22 08:54 akonadi-loreleil.SyiBN6 drwxrwxrwt 2 root root 60 2015-03-22 08:53 .ICE-unix drwx------ 2 loreleil loreleil 60 2015-03-22 08:53 ssh-rPDu5Cd60TRP drwx------ 2 kdm nogroup 60 2015-03-22 08:53 kde-kdm drwx------ 2 kdm nogroup 60 2015-03-22 08:53 ksocket-kdm drwxrwxrwt 2 root root 60 2015-03-22 08:52 .X11-unix -r--r--r-- 1 root root 11 2015-03-22 08:52 .X0-lock drwx------ 2 loreleil loreleil 40 1970-01-01 01:00 orbit-loreleil [11:12:57]:/tmp$
Quels sont donc les droits actuels sur le répertoire [mono]/tmp[/mono], à présent … ?


PS: 4.2. Étapes du programme d’installation ceci te sera bien utile, d’ici peu … :033

C’est un porblème classique par exemple lorsqu’on déplie une archive «.» sous root sous /tmp, les droits de tmp deviennent ceux du répertoire déplier. Un simple
chmod 1777 /tmp
arrange les choses. Il faut également regarder les propriétaires du répertoire personnel et les droits de /run et /var/tmp

[quote=“fran.b”]C’est un porblème classique par exemple lorsqu’on déplie une archive «.» sous root sous /tmp, les droits de tmp deviennent ceux du répertoire déplier. Un simple
chmod 1777 /tmp
arrange les choses. Il faut également regarder les propriétaires du répertoire personnel et les droits de /run et /var/tmp[/quote]

je le fais systématiquement après chaque clonage, sans quoi plus de session graphique.

ce qui m’évite bien sûr de:

PS: 4.2. Étapes du programme d'installation ceci te sera bien utile, d'ici peu non merci, et Jessie se clône aussi sans problème.

bonjour
le chmod 1777 /tmp faut le faire oû ? parce que je l’ai fait ,ça m’a pas renvoyé d’erreur mais ça n’a rien changé à mon probleme, et j’ai regardé dans le dossier tmp il est vide

Bon il nous faut une recopie de l’écran, prend une photo, ce que tu veux mais là on perd notre temps à imaginer à partir de rien ce que pourrait être le problème.